| All the stuff I bought from Newegg, quite pleased with the purchase except for the dead hard drive : ( ![]() ECS 780G Mobo, Really nice motherboard, the 780G series, you can allocate up to 1Gb of ram to the onboard video, and it runs Vista without any lag (re-formatted and put XP back on because its faster) ![]() ![]() Ugly Rosewill case + Freebie 450W PSU. AVOID!! Crap plastic material used for the case, and all the teeth on the front panel broke off so I cant clip the front panel on anymore. Rosewill is sending me a new frontpanel at their cost, so Im waiting for that to arrive in a few day's time. ![]() AMD 4200+ Bleh, what can I say, AMD really needs to catch a wake up call now, Intel is poesklaaping them around. Super Pi 1M in 40sec, what an ...... useless cpu, my sister's E2160 does that around 20seconds. But its sufficient for Microsoft Office Suite and Photoshop, so Im not complaining. ![]() Finally, everything plugged in, apart from the dead Seagate HDD, which Newegg should RMA without any hassle. ![]() Dead Seagate 320Gb HDD, The new barracuda 11, with the single 320gb platter. In theory, it should be less noisy and produce less heat due to the fact its running on a single 320gb platter instead of two 160gb platters. 7200rpm and 16mb cache, all sounds pretty good... but its dead : ( ![]() There, a cheap sub $500 PC. Now I just need to wait for the G45 board to be released and I can build another PC for my sister. Apprantely the G45's onboard video can decode blue-ray without much lag, and capable of light gaming as well. Sounds promising, guess I will just have to find out in a few month's time.
